WebProblem 1. Find all points on the graph of y = x 3 - 3 x where the tangent line is parallel to the x axis (or horizontal tangent line). Solution to Problem 1: Lines that are parallel to the x axis have slope = 0. The slope of a tangent line to the graph of y = x 3 - 3 x is given by the first derivative y '. y ' = 3 x 2 - 3. WebAnswer (1 of 5): Given y = f(x) = x³ − 12x + 24 ==> dy/dx = 3x² − 12 . If the tangent be to x-axis to the curve y = f(x), then dy/dx = 0 ==> 3x² − 12 = 0 or x = ± 2 ==> corresponding value of y = 8 & 40 . So the required points on the curve are P(2, 8) and Q (-2, 40) . Given = y=x^3 This curve passes through origin x=0. The slope of the X-axis is zero. The slope of the given curve at any point is dy/dx=3x^2 The slope of the curve at x=0 is m=3(0)^2=0 Since the slope of the curve is zero at x=0 …
